Transaction 22570cc4e71f7dccd1051966986474fc1635fa87049005971d2de69d003e5358
2 Input
2 Outputs
- 22570cc4e71f7dccd1051966986474fc1635fa87049005971d2de69d003e5358:0
- 22570cc4e71f7dccd1051966986474fc1635fa87049005971d2de69d003e5358:1
value 22795000000
address 17Qi6nLTAezionKKTFrNHNvwFcZWpdyRXw
value 136189
address 17xyy9pNTvVhv8E8StwjCGYr5DTStPVRBV